Roman Reigns

Roman Reigns is a professional wrestler and actor. He is of Samoan and Italian descent and comes from a family of professional wrestlers. His father, Sika Anoa’i, and brother, Rosey, who both competed in WWE.

Roman Reigns age

Roman Reigns was born on May 25, 1985, in Pensacola, Florida. He is 38 years old.

Roman Reigns family

Reigns, whose birth name is Leati Joseph Anoa’i. Roman Reigns’ father is Sika Anoa’i, a retired professional wrestler who competed as one half of the tag team The Wild Samoans.

His mother’s name is Patricia Anoa’i. Reigns has two older brothers, David and Matthew “Rosey” Anoa’i, who was also a professional wrestler and competed in WWE. Unfortunately, Rosey passed away in 2017 at the age of 47 due to congestive heart failure. Reigns also has a younger sister named Vanessa.

Roman Reigns Football career

Growing up, Reigns played football and was a standout defensive lineman at both Escambia High School in Pensacola. Later he played at Pensacola Catholic High School. He went on to play football at Georgia Tech and then transferred to the University of Minnesota, where he was a three-year starter and earned All-Big Ten honors.

Reign was signed by the Minnesota Vikings in 2007 but was released from the team before the regular season began. He then pursued a career in professional wrestling, training at the Wild Samoan Training Center, which was founded by his uncle, Afa Anoa’i.

WWE Roman Reigns

Reigns made his debut in WWE in 2012 as a member of The Shield, a stable that also included wrestlers Dean Ambrose and Seth Rollins. The Shield quickly became one of the most dominant factions in WWE history, winning multiple championships and engaging in memorable feuds with other wrestlers and factions.

After The Shield disbanded in 2014, Reigns went on to have a successful singles career in WWE. He won his first WWE World Heavyweight Championship in 2015 and has since won multiple championships, including the Intercontinental Championship and the United States Championship. Reigns is also a four-time WrestleMania main eventer, having headlined the event in 2015, 2016, 2017, and 2018.

Reigns has been known for his intense and hard-hitting wrestling style, as well as his charismatic personality and ability to connect with fans. He is often referred to as “The Big Dog” and is recognized as one of WWE’s top stars.

In 2018, Reigns announced that he had been diagnosed with leukemia and would be taking time off from wrestling to receive treatment. He returned to WWE in 2019 and has since resumed his position as one of the company’s top stars gimmicking the head of the table and Tribal chief names.

Roman Reigns wife

The wrestler’s wife’is Galina Joelle Becker, whom he married in December 2014. The couple has been together since their college days and has been in a long-term relationship before tying the knot.

Roman Reigns children

Together, they have five children: a daughter named Joelle, who was born in 2008, and twin sons named Dominic and Koa, who was born in 2016. In 2019, Reigns revealed that he and his wife had welcomed two more children, but he has not shared their names publicly.

Roman Reigns Films and achievements

Reigns has also appeared in several films, including “Hobbs & Shaw” and “The Wrong Missy.” He has been recognized for his contributions to professional wrestling with numerous awards, including the PWI Wrestler of the Year in 2014 and the Wrestling Observer Newsletter’s Most Outstanding Wrestler in 2017.
